6.9 Apartment heating fl ow and return
connections
Connections from the Heatrae Sadia HI-MAX INSTANT
to the apartment heating system are located at the
bottom of the unit unless stand-off assemblies A or
D are used. In which case the heating fl ow and return
connections are located at the top of the unit. See
Figure 23 on page 26 for more details.
The Heatrae Sadia HI-MAX INSTANT Indirect units
are suitable to connect to either radiator type heating
systems or underfl oor heating systems.
When installing indirect units with underfl oor heating
it is important that the underfl oor heating system
is capable of mixing the heating fl ow down to the
desired temperatures.
6.10 Apartment heating safety valve discharge
connection
The safety valve discharge has a 15mm pipe connection
which is provided in the fi rst fi x rail on indirect units so
that all plumbing work can be carried out during the
fi rst fi x stage of the installation.
The discharge pipework should have a continuous fall
to a suitable drain and be in a frost free environment.
It is good practice to fi t a tundish to facilitate
commissioning and servicing. A trap should be used
when discharging to drain.
See BS6798 for advice on safety discharge pipework.
WARNING
Although the amount of water discharged
from the safety valve is not likely to be great,
it is important to note that it is likely to be hot
and carry a risk of scalding.

6.11 Electrical connections

Cable entry into the Heatrae Sadia HI-MAX
INSTANT unit is from the top of the unit through the
cable gland on the top of the fi rst fi x rail.
Ensure all casing screws are fi tted as these
provide earth continuity throughout the casings.
The power supply MUST be earthed. The supply
cable should be 3 core sheathed and must be routed
through the cable grip provided with the outer
sheath of the cable fi rmly secured by tightening
the screws on the cable grip in accordance with BS
EN 7671:2008.
6.11.1 Heating Controls
The Heatrae Sadia HI-MAX INSTANT requires a
programmable room thermostat to control the
apartment heating. The switching cable should
be routed through the cable grommet on the
top of the fi rst fi x rail and secured using the cable
clamp on the back plate of the HIU before being
routed to the Installer terminal box. Refer to the
programmable room thermostat instructions for
more details.

Ensure the installation is earth bonded in
accordance with BS EN 7671:2008. An earthing stud
is fi tted on the back plate of the HIU, its location is
detailed in Figure 27 below.
